Re: The Qloader
It is tricky, the q-loader is well made but expensive and can ruin your day. Some people do like them, but you have limited ammo and a more complex system.
It is a good sniper system if you are playing a true sniper role because you get low profile and still a good amount of paint vs a tac cap. My one friend really likes his q-loader, it has a lot to do with play style. I know more people that hated their q-loader than liked it, but there are still a lot of guys that really liked it. So if it makes sense to you then it could probably work really well. |

Re: The Qloader
Quote:
Yes, and you need a permanent modification where you cannot go back to using a cyclone once using Q-Loader. The little piece that sticks out from the gun and rests inside the cyclone has to be removed in order to fit the adapter. This will screw up your cyclone feed if you want it back on and will need a whole new side of the gun in order to use it normally.

Re: The Qloader
Quote:
IMO, use a tac cap, and maybe keep a standard X7 hopper handy of you're on the field and run into a situation where you need to load more paint. You have the phenom which is nice and consistant. HPA and a barrel with bore options are the only other things that will make it more accurate. I think in a sniper role a low profile harness and some sort of concealable ghillie apparatus would be more useful to you than any marker upgrade. |
